#VU69479 OS Command Injection in apache-airflow-providers-apache-pinot - CVE-2022-38649
Published: November 22, 2022
Vulnerability identifier: #VU69479
Vulnerability risk: High
CVSSv4.0: C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Amber
CVE-ID: CVE-2022-38649
CWE-ID: CWE-78
Exploitation vector: Remote access

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ary shell commands on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ation. A remote attacker can pass specially crafted data to the application and control commands executed in the task execution context, without write access to DAG files.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
Remediation
Install updates from vendor's website.
